Output e95a61d965c2760991228332583a9d27eaf59a3a0c9b09603dba68edf274d1e0:4

value
3009362
script pubkey
OP_0 OP_PUSHBYTES_20 bf1e3a459262f5a59b51717aee43ff813cfa6561
address
bc1qhu0r53vjvt66tx63w9awusllsy705etp7e2lfv
transaction
e95a61d965c2760991228332583a9d27eaf59a3a0c9b09603dba68edf274d1e0
spent
true